Resonant optical nonlinearity measurement of Yb3+/Al3+ codoped optical fibers by use of a long-period fiber grating pair

Metadata Downloads
Abstract
A new method of measuring optical nonlinearity for resonant nonlinear optical fibers is proposed. A long-period fiber grating (LPG) pair was used to measure the nonlinear refractive index n(2) of a Yb3+ /Al3+ codoped optical fiber, which was spliced between the two LPGs, as the fiber was pumped with a laser diode. The nonlinear refractive index of the Yb3+ /Al3+ codoped fiber near 1580 nm depended on the pump power. As the pump power increased, the nonlinear refractive index decreased. At launched pump powers of 2-8 mW, the nonlinear refractive index of the Yb3+ /Al3+ codoped fiber near 1580 nm was similar to7.5 x 10(15) m(2)/W. (C) 2002 Optical Society of America.
